
Restoring the source: two years of impact in the Upper Letaba Catchment
Between March 2024 and February 2026, the Upper Letaba Catchment Restoration Project transformed the landscape of the Upper Groot Letaba catchment while strengthening partnerships, creating jobs, and securing vital water resources for the region. What began as an invasive alien plant clearing initiative evolved into a landscape-scale restoration effort that is now helping to catalyse long-term stewardship, scientific research, and community collaboration across the Wolkberg escarpment.
